Making the Cheesecake Filling
- Soften the Cream Cheese. Place the softened cream cheese in a medium bowl and beat on medium speed until smooth and free of lumps, about 1‑2 minutes. This creates a silky base that will melt evenly inside the bread.
- Incorporate Sweeteners. Add granulated sugar, maple syrup, and vanilla to the cream cheese. Beat until the mixture is light and fluffy; the maple adds a subtle autumnal note that pairs with the pumpkin.
- Finish with Egg Yolk. Blend in the egg yolk just until incorporated. The yolk acts as a gentle binder, giving the filling a custard‑like texture that will set perfectly when baked.
Assembling & Baking the Finished Loaf
- Core the Bread. Once the pumpkin loaf has cooled for about 10 minutes, run a thin knife or a small biscuit cutter around the center, leaving a ½‑inch border. Gently lift out the core and set it aside; it will become a tasty crumb topping.
- Pipe the Filling. Transfer the cheesecake mixture to a piping bag fitted with a large round tip. Fill the hollowed center, spreading gently to the edges. The filling should be about ¾‑inch high; any excess can be dolloped on top.
- Prepare the Streusel. In a small bowl combine flour, brown sugar, cinnamon, and the cold butter. Using fingertips or a pastry cutter, rub the butter into the dry ingredients until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s.
- Top & Bake. Sprinkle the streusel evenly over the filled loaf, then place the reserved pumpkin core pieces back on top for extra texture. Return the pan to the oven and bake for an additional 20‑25 minutes, or until the cheesecake is set and the streusel is golden brown.
- Cool & Serve. Allow the loaf to rest for at least 15 minutes before slicing. This resting period lets the cheesecake firm up, preventing it from spilling out. Serve warm with a drizzle of caramel or a dollop of whipped cream for an extra indulgent touch.
Tips & Tricks
Perfecting the Recipe
Use Real Pumpkin Puree. Freshly roasted pumpkin or a high‑quality canned puree gives the best flavor and moisture without watery excess.
Room‑Temperature Cream Cheese. Soften the cheese fully before beating; this prevents lumps and ensures a silky filling.
Don’t Over‑Bake the Core. Remove the loaf from the oven as soon as a toothpick comes out clean; over‑baking dries the crumb.
Flavor Enhancements
Add a teaspoon of orange zest to the batter for a citrusy lift, or swirl in a tablespoon of pumpkin‑spice jam into the cheesecake filling before piping. A pinch of sea salt on the streusel right before baking heightens the sweet‑savory contrast.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
Skipping the cooling step before filling can cause the cheesecake to melt and run out of the loaf. Also, be careful not to over‑mix the batter; excess gluten makes the bread tough instead of tender.
Pro Tips
Chill the Streusel. Keep the butter bits cold until they hit the oven; this yields a flaky, buttery topping.
Use a Water Bath for the Filling. If you’re nervous about the cheesecake cracking, place the loaf pan in a larger roasting pan filled with hot water during the second bake.
